直接写个脚本提交不可以吗,为什么一定要通过java提交呢?

Dream-底限 <zhan...@akulaku.com> 于2020年8月19日周三 下午4:41写道:

> 好的,感谢
>
> Jeff Zhang <zjf...@gmail.com> 于2020年8月19日周三 下午4:31写道:
>
> > Zeppelin 最近在做这样的API来提交Flink Job,这里有个例子可以参考下
> >
> >
> https://github.com/zjffdu/zeppelin/blob/ZEPPELIN-4981/zeppelin-interpreter-integration/src/test/java/org/apache/zeppelin/integration/ZSessionIntegrationTest.java#L307
> >
> > 可以加入钉钉群讨论,钉钉群号:32803524
> >
> >
> >
> > Dream-底限 <zhan...@akulaku.com> 于2020年8月19日周三 下午4:27写道:
> >
> > > hi、
> > > 请问你说的是自己拼接cli字符串,然后通过java调用子进程执行的这种方式吗
> > >
> > >
> >
> 我先前也是这么做的,但感觉比较怪异,这种方式有一个问题是貌似没办法直接返回applicationId,要从日志里面筛选好像,再就是没办法判断提交是否成功,貌似也是从日志来做,请问这个applicationId在提交的时候除了从日志筛选有其他的获取方式吗
> > >
> > > wxpcc <wxp4...@outlook.com> 于2020年8月19日周三 下午4:09写道:
> > >
> > > > 大概可以用,YarnClusterDescriptor
> > > >
> > > > 命令行方式封装提交对于后续升级更加方便一些,个人建议
> > > >
> > > >
> > > >
> > > > --
> > > > Sent from: http://apache-flink.147419.n8.nabble.com/
> > >
> >
> >
> > --
> > Best Regards
> >
> > Jeff Zhang
> >
>

回复